Thermo Proteome Discoverer uses a file format based on SQLite3. I
applaud there choice here, as it makes it insanely easy to get data
out of it, but some documentation on the format would be greatly
appreciated.

In particular, I am working on a Ruby library for reading data from
MSF file, but the Spectra table encodes the spectrum in some non-
obvious binary format. Anyone want to give me a hint as to what the
encoding is? It looks like a serialize C Struct, which I can deal with
just fine, but I need to know the fields & types to do so.
